Add filter to woocommerce_order_again_button to match WC_Form_Handler->order_again

This commit adds the `woocommerce_valid_order_statuses_for_order_again` filter to the conditional check
before displaying the order-again button.

The purpose is to enable consistency when altering the valid order again statuses - in the past a dev would
need to use this filter to let the order through the form handler, and then override the template file for a really
trivial reason just to get the button to display.
